Roxanne Paisible is the Associate Director of Advocacy for GHAI’s Road Safety program. Prior to joining GHAI, she served as the senior manager for InterAction’s Children and Youth Initiative and advocated for U.S. Government policies that promote the well-being of children and youth globally. She has also held advocacy roles with the African Development Bank, PATH, Oxfam, and the International Rescue Committee. She advised the African Development Bank on their human capital advocacy strategy and provided strategic advocacy guidance at PATH to increase access to lifesaving immunization services for children and women. She also oversaw media relations for Oxfam in Haiti and managed the International Rescue Committee’s engagement with U.S. policymakers on refugee resettlement issues and the 2010 earthquake in Haiti.
